Cyndi Lauper’s "Live in Paris 1987" stands as a definitive visual and sonic document of the 1980s. Captured on March 12, 1987, at Le Zénith, this concert marked the final stop of her world-famous True Colors Tour. Today, fans and collectors seek "updated" versions—remastered visuals and high-fidelity audio—to relive the energy of a superstar at her peak. The Iconic Le Zénith Performance

The Paris show was more than just a tour date; it was an electrifying showcase of Lauper’s range, from the high-energy punk-pop of "She Bop" to the soulful, stripped-down resonance of "True Colors". Directed by Andy Morahan, the concert film is praised for its "fire" performances and artistic editing, which includes a charming intro of Cyndi sightseeing through the streets of Paris.
